Top 5 Toddlers Games on Android in Argentina: Q3 2023 Performance
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 toddlers games on Android in Argentina for Q3 2023, including metrics on downloads, revenue, and active users.
In Q3 2023, the top 5 toddlers games on the Android platform in Argentina demonstrated varied performance trends in terms of we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a closer look at each app's performance based on data from Sensor Tower.
My Cat - Virtual pet simulator showed fluctuations in both revenue and downloads. Weekly revenue ranged from approximately $1.4K to $2.1K, peaking in early August. Downloads experienced an initial drop from 16.4K to around 9.9K by mid-August but saw a resurgence to 15.2K in early September. Active users followed a similar trend, starting at 50.9K and ending the quarter at 35.4K, with a peak of 49.3K in early September.
Lingokids - Play and Learn experienced a significant increase in downloads, starting at 2.2K and reaching up to 11.8K by early September. Revenue showed a steady climb, peaking at about $1.4K in early September. Active users also increased, starting at 12.3K and peaking at 22.4K in early September before dropping to 13.1K by the end of the quarter.
Buddy.ai: Fun Learning Games maintained stable weekly revenue, hovering around $800-$1.2K. Downloads saw a notable rise from 14.1K to 20.6K in late July, with a peak of 18.1K in early September. Active users increased from 26.5K to 31.8K by mid-September, before a slight drop to 24.6K at the end of the quarter.
PK XD: Fun, friends & games had a strong performance in downloads, peaking at 27.9K in mid-August before stabilizing around 10.8K by the end of September. Revenue ranged from $449 to $922, with a peak in late July. Active users remained high throughout the quarter, peaking at 438.9K in early August.
Speech Blubs: Language Therapy had more modest figures, with downloads ranging from 390 to 1K, peaking in late July. Revenue varied between $175 and $424, with a peak in late July. Active users fluctuated throughout the quarter, starting at 1.2K and ending at 920.
